#dc1f7e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dc1f7e is composed of 86.3% red, 12.2% green and 49.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 85.9% magenta, 42.7%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 329.8 degrees, a saturation of 75.3% and a lightness of 49.2%. #dc1f7e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3efc with #b90000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

#dc1f7e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dc1f7e has RGB values of R:220, G:31, B:126 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.86, Y:0.43,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 14425982.
